- Title
Progress beyond COVID: Ongoing benefits of a virtual adolescent PHP.
- Authors
Marcus, Marissa; Frazier, Elisabeth; Hedrick, Molly; May, Emily; Beaudoin, Gabrielle
- Abstract
Partial hospitalization is a unique form of mental health care that provides more intensive care than traditional outpatient settings, but unlike inpatient hospitalization, allows patients the freedom to remain in their home and social environment outside of program hours, encouraging immediate practice of therapeutic skills in context and maintaining protective factors such as friendships and extracurricular activities.
